Vietnam, biggest foreign investor in Laos in 2009

HANOI, Mar 09, 2010 (Xinhua via COMTEX) -- Vietnam was the biggest foreign investor in Laos in 2009 with 48 projects valued at 1.5 billion U.

S. dollars, the Lao newspaper Vientiane Times reported Tuesday.

So far this year, Vietnam continues to be the leading foreign investor in Laos, said Khamla Nakkhavong, Vice President of the Vietnam Cooperation and Investment Business Association in Laos of the Lao National Chamber of Commerce and Industry, the body that assembles all Vietnamese companies that are doing business in Laos.

Vietnam's investment is not only poured into projects of hydropower, mining and industrial crop plantations but has also been expanding into telecoms, finance, banking and insurance, said Khamla.

Lao investment environment in the past few years has become more attractive, offering more incentives for foreign investors.

It partially brings in the expansion of Vietnam's investment in the country, said Khamla.
